Selecionar parte de um texto no edit.
Boa tarde galera,
preciso fazer uma ´frescura´ necessária aqui no meu sistema e gostaria de ver se é possível. e se vcs podem me dar uma dica se possível..
tenho um edit que recebe um valor de uma pesquisa.
o edit ficaria com o seguinte conteúdo por exemplo.
Avenida Paulita 0
gostaria de deixar o ´0´ selecionado para ele digitar o número..
seria tipo um SelectAll, mas só nesse dígito..
teria como??
valeu pessoal
preciso fazer uma ´frescura´ necessária aqui no meu sistema e gostaria de ver se é possível. e se vcs podem me dar uma dica se possível..
tenho um edit que recebe um valor de uma pesquisa.
o edit ficaria com o seguinte conteúdo por exemplo.
Avenida Paulita 0
gostaria de deixar o ´0´ selecionado para ele digitar o número..
seria tipo um SelectAll, mas só nesse dígito..
teria como??
valeu pessoal
Jm
Curtidas 0
Melhor post
Rodc
18/03/2008
Edit1.HideSelection := false; Edit1.SelStart := 16; Edit1.SelLength := 1;
GOSTEI 1
Mais Respostas
Wanderok
17/03/2008
Nao conheço esta possibilidade de deixar o cursos em edicao na posicao ´0´ para o usuário nao precisar ir até ele.
Sugiro 2 edits
edit1.text := ´AVENIDA PAULISTA´;
edit2.text := ´0´;
edit2.setfocus;
------------
ao sair do edit2.text.....
vEndereco := edit1.text + ´ ´ + edit2.text;
:(:(:(
Sugiro 2 edits
edit1.text := ´AVENIDA PAULISTA´;
edit2.text := ´0´;
edit2.setfocus;
------------
ao sair do edit2.text.....
vEndereco := edit1.text + ´ ´ + edit2.text;
:(:(:(
GOSTEI 0
Rodc
17/03/2008
Use também antes dos outros comandos este aqui.
Edit1.SetFocus();
GOSTEI 0
Wanderok
17/03/2008
ÓTIMO !!!!
agora só falta ele descobrir que AVENIDA PAULISTA sugere a posicao 16 ... :D:D:D
agora só falta ele descobrir que AVENIDA PAULISTA sugere a posicao 16 ... :D:D:D
GOSTEI 0
Rodc
17/03/2008
agora só falta ele descobrir que AVENIDA PAULISTA sugere a posicao 16 ... :D:D:D
Não podemos dar tudo de mão beijada, né!! rsssss....
O cara que pense na lógica de programação para encontrar a posição do número dentro do texto...
GOSTEI 0
Wanderok
17/03/2008
ahhhhhhhhhhhhhhhhhhhhhhhhhh bao !!!!
Saquei :D:D:D
Bem lembrado, afinal, caldo de galinha e um pequeno exercíciozinho de raciocínio lógico não faz mal a ninguém não é mesmo ??? kkkk :D:D:D
Valeu !!!!
Saquei :D:D:D
Bem lembrado, afinal, caldo de galinha e um pequeno exercíciozinho de raciocínio lógico não faz mal a ninguém não é mesmo ??? kkkk :D:D:D
Valeu !!!!
GOSTEI 0
Rodc
17/03/2008
vou deixar mais uma dica então.
Pode ser usado a função LastDelimiter() para retornar a posição do último espaço em branco do texto. :wink:
Pode ser usado a função LastDelimiter() para retornar a posição do último espaço em branco do texto. :wink:
GOSTEI 0
Wanderok
17/03/2008
Ótimo.
Isto melhora muito minha dica em http://forum.devmedia.com.br/viewtopic.php?t=93962
Obrigado !!!!
Isto melhora muito minha dica em http://forum.devmedia.com.br/viewtopic.php?t=93962
Obrigado !!!!
GOSTEI 0